- 0
- 0
- 约2.17千字
- 约 16页
- 2017-09-12 发布于上海
- 举报
第七章非线性方程的数值解法Chapter7NumericalMethods
第七章 非线性方程的数值解法 /*Chapter7 Numerical Methods for Nonlinear Equations*/ * 求 f (x) = 0 的根 原理:若 f ?C[a, b],且 f (a) · f (b) 0, 则 f 在 (a, b) 上必有一根。 1. 二分法 a b x1 x2 a b When to stop? 或 不能保证 x 的精度 x* ?2 x x* §6.1.1 二分法 误差 分析: 二分初始时刻 有误差 二分k 次产生的 xk 有误差 对于给定的精度 ? ,可估计二分法所需的步数 k : ①简单; ② 对f (x) 要求不高(只要连续即可) . ①无法求复根及偶重根 ② 收敛慢 注:用二分法求根,最好先给出 f (x) 草图以确定根的大概位置。或用搜索程序,将[a, b]分为若干小区间,对每一个满足 f (ak)·f (bk) 0 的区间调用二分法程序,可找出区间[a, b]内的多个根,且不必要求 f (a)·f (b) 0 。 §6.1.1 二分法 2. 不动点迭代法 /* Fixed-Point Iteration */ f (x) = 0 x = g (x) 等价变换 f (x) 的根 g (x) 的不动点 思路 从一个初值 x0 出发,计算 x1 = g(x0
原创力文档

文档评论(0)